{"count":1,"message":"Results returned successfully","results":[{"odiNumber":11436342,"manufacturer":"Mitsubishi Motors North America, Inc.","crash":false,"fire":false,"numberOfInjuries":0,"numberOfDeaths":0,"dateOfIncident":"10/09/2021","dateComplaintFiled":"10/11/2021","vin":"JA4AD3A3XGZ","components":"POWER TRAIN","summary":"My 2016 outlander started having a burning plastic smell. I made a trip back home and thankfully made it safely because I started having issues with accelerating. I would push the gas gently and barely go but my car would Rev up to 4-5 rpms. I could put my foot to the floor and it wouldn't speed up at all. After checking the transmission fluid and seeing it was on the lower side we added a little more in hopes it would help but it did not. I was low on gas after my trip so I drove to the closet store so it wouldn't be sitting with no gas and At this point the transmission service required warning came up.  It started revving up even worse with the slightest touch of the gas and I could barley get it to back out of a spot or take off from a stop sign. We were trying to get it to a neutral location that we knew it would be safe and while drinking it there it started jumping and the check engine light came on. I had it towed to a repair shop who verified it is a transmission issue but said they recommend a dealer fix only. My car is a 2016, had 1 previous owner and only has 58347 miles on it.","products":[{"type":"Vehicle","productYear":"2016","productMake":"MITSUBISHI","productModel":"OUTLANDER","manufacturer":"Mitsubishi Motors North America, Inc."}]}]}
